Understanding Pedestrian Accident Claims

Pedestrian accident claims involve proving fault, documenting injuries, and seeking recovery for medical expenses and other losses.

Because California has deadlines for filing, it is important to seek guidance promptly to protect your rights.

Definition and Explanation of Pedestrian Accident Claims

These claims allow individuals injured by another party’s negligence to seek compensation from the at fault driver or their insurer.

Key Elements and Processes in Pedestrian Accident Claims

Elements include establishing duty, breach, causation, and damages, followed by investigation, evidence gathering, negotiation, and, if needed, filing a lawsuit.

Key Terms and Glossary

The glossary here explains common terms you may encounter as your claim moves forward.

Negligence

Failure to exercise reasonable care that results in harm to another person.

Damages

Compensable losses such as medical bills, lost wages, and pain and suffering.

Comparative Negligence

A legal principle that adjusts compensation based on each party’s degree of fault.

Settlement and Resolution

Ways to resolve a claim, including negotiated settlements and court judgments.

Pro Tips for Pedestrian Accident Claims

Keep detailed records

Document medical visits, police reports, and all correspondence with insurers.

Seek medical evaluation promptly

Even small symptoms can become serious, so get checked soon after an incident.

Avoid giving statements without legal advice

Consult with our team before speaking with insurers or other parties.

In California, most claims must be filed within two years of the date of injury. Some cases involve different deadlines, so a timely consultation helps determine the exact timeline for your situation. Missing a deadline can limit your recovery, so prompt legal advice is important.

Damages in pedestrian cases typically include medical bills, rehabilitation costs, lost wages, and pain and suffering. In some cases, you may also claim future medical needs and reduced earning capacity. Punitive damages are uncommon in most pedestrian accident claims.

Yes. A lawyer can explain your options, negotiate with insurers, and prepare for litigation if a fair settlement isn’t reached. Having guidance from someone who knows local procedures can improve your chances of a favorable outcome.

Fault is determined through evidence such as traffic laws, police reports, eyewitness statements, and physical evidence at the scene. California uses comparative fault rules to adjust recovery based on each party’s degree of responsibility.

If the at-fault driver lacks insurance, you may still pursue compensation through your own uninsured motorist coverage or, in some cases, city or property owner liability. An attorney can help identify available options and next steps.
